Disability shower installation services focus on creating accessible bathing environments tailored to individuals with mobility challenges or other physical limitations. These services typically involve the installation of walk-in showers, low-threshold entries, grab bars, and non-slip flooring to promote safety and ease of use. Contractors may also include features such as adjustable showerheads, seating options, and specialized controls to accommodate various needs. The goal is to design a functional, safe, and comfortable space that supports independence and enhances daily living routines.
This service addresses several common problems faced by individuals with disabilities or limited mobility. Traditional showers can pose risks of slips, falls, or difficulty entering and exiting, which can lead to injuries or increased dependence on caregivers. Disability shower installations aim to eliminate these hazards by providing barrier-free access and safety features. Additionally, these modifications can reduce the need for assistance, offering greater privacy and dignity for users. The improvements often contribute to a more accessible home environment, making routine bathing safer and more convenient.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Big Bend,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the setup and materials used. Basic installations may be closer to the lower end, while custom features can increase the price.
Material Expenses - The price of materials such as accessible shower pans, grab bars, and non-slip flooring can vary from $500 to $2,500. Higher-end options with advanced features tend to be at the upper end of this range.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for professional installation generally fall between $500 and $2,000. The total depends on the project's scope and the local service providers’ rates in Big Bend, WI.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ses might include permits, modifications to plumbing, or custom fixtures, which can add $200 to $1,000 to the overall cost. These costs vary based on the specific requirements of the installation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
